Abstract
An automatic compensated torque balance for the measurement of magnetic anisotropies from helium temperatures upwards in the range of torques 10-104 erg was constructed. The temperature dependence K1 was measured on the ferrite Cu009Mn061Fe23O4 and the energy splitting Et similar, equals 1540 cm−1 of the triplet d of the ion Fe2+ caused by the trigonal component of the spinel crystal field was determined.Keywords
